
Integrin
Integrin inhibitors target integrins, a family of cell surface receptors that play a crucial role in cell adhesion, migration, and signal transduction. Integrins are involved in the regulation of the cell cycle, particularly in processes such as cell division and differentiation. Inhibiting integrins can disrupt these processes, leading to cell cycle arrest and apoptosis, making these inhibitors valuable in cancer research and the study of metastasis.
